前面已经提到了可以直接使用 Sftp 来访问 Vps,如果需要临时的搭建Ftp,则按下面的指南进行。
下载 pyftpdlib 库
在 Putty 使用如下命令,下载 pyftpdlib 库并解压缩。
cd /root
wget http://pyftpdlib.googlecode.com/files/pyftpdlib-0.7.0.tar.gz
tar xzvf pyftpdlib-0.7.0.tar.gz
解压缩完毕后,我们可以临时开启ftp了:
开启匿名ftp服务
开启匿名ftp服务,主目录为 /var/www ;默认是21端口;-d 是设置主目录。
cd /root/pyftpdlib-0.7.0/
python -m pyftpdlib.ftpserver -d /var/www
运行该命令后,客户端就可以使用 anonymous 帐号登录,下载了。
按 Ctrl+C 结束 Ftp 服务器。
开启允许写入ftp服务
添加 -w 参数即可允许写入,不可以长时间开,小心被其它人删除数据。
cd /root/pyftpdlib-0.7.0/
python -m pyftpdlib.ftpserver -w -d /var/www
运行该命令后,客户端就可以使用 anonymous 帐号登录,下载和上传了。同样按 Ctrl+C 结束 Ftp 服务器。